Lance Goss   •   Senior Vice President   •   HHHunt Apartment Living   •   Richmond, Va.

HHHunt Corporation has promoted Lance Goss to Senior Vice President of HHHunt Apartment Living. Goss oversees the strategic direction as well as the financial and physical operations of HHHunt Apartment Living, which includes sales, marketing, maintenance and leasing operations for nearly 8,000 apartment homes in Maryland, Virginia, North Carolina, South Carolina, Tennessee and Georgia. He is an active member of the Virginia Tech Property Management Advisory Board. Goss is also an active participant in the National Apartment Association as well as other local apartment associations throughout HHHunt’s footprint.

Jeff Harris   •   Regional Partner   •   Transwestern Development Company   •   Charlotte, N.C.

Transwestern Development Company announced it has expanded its Southeast team with the addition of Jeff Harris. In his new role as Regional Partner, Harris is responsible for sourcing and executing development projects throughout the region with a primary focus on multifamily and mixed-use properties. Harris was previously Division President for the Carolinas at Lennar Multifamily Communities. Prior to joining Lennar, Harris served as Executive Vice President and Regional Investment Director for Post Properties’ East region.

 

Andrea Wheeler   •   Regional Property Manager   •   Christoher Community, Inc.   •   Syracuse, N.Y.

Christopher Community, Inc. announced Andrea Wheeler as Regional Property Manager. Wheeler began her 15-year career in the property management field as a Leasing Consultant. Most recently, Wheeler owned and operated an in-home daycare for three years and has been a licensed real estate salesperson for two years. She is also currently a member of the Snowbelt Housing Board, which provides grants to struggling families in Lewis County, N.Y., to improve their home. Wheeler has an Associate's Degree in Business Management from Jefferson Community College. She is also certified as an Occupancy Specialist in fair housing and NYS Housing Code of Ethics.

 

Miranda Dean   •   Vice President of Capital Markets   •   The Calida Group   •   Las Vegas

The Calida Group announced Miranda Dean as a Vice President of Capital Markets. Dean brings over a decade of experience in the commercial real estate and fintech spaces, having specialized in debt origination, capital raising from both domestic and international investors, investor relations and business operations. Dean was most recently Investment Sale Broker with Archer Real Estate. In her previous roles, she oversaw debt originations and underwriting, as well as SMA Portfolio Management, at Nuveen Real Estate.

Heidi Rooney   •   Director of Enterprise Sales   •   Leonardo247   •   New Jersey

Leonardo247 has promoted Heidi Rooney to Director of Enterprise Sales. Rooney, who has more than 16 years of experience in multifamily, joined Leonardo247 in 2018 as Regional Vice President of Sales for the Northeast. In her new role, Rooney will continue as the RVP for the Northeast region, while also overseeing international sales and expansion into new markets. She began her multifamily career at Sure Deposit.

 

Cass McFadden   •   Global Head of Sustainability   •   Cortland   •   Atlanta

Cortland has appointed Cass McFadden to the newly created role of Global Head of Sustainability. Reporting to Cortland’s President of Investment Management, Jason Kern, McFadden will be responsible for driving innovative strategies to achieve Cortland’s sustainability goals across the portfolio on behalf of residents, associates and investors. McFadden brings a wealth of industry knowledge to Cortland following stints as Vice President of Sustainability at Bozzuto and Director of Energy Management for AvalonBay. McFadden will be responsible for road-mapping the vision and targets for ESG programs, including optimizing energy, water and waste performance at the asset level.

Will Drummond   •   Chief Financial Officer   •   Fogelman Properties   •   Memphis, Tenn.

Fogelman Properties appointed Will Drummond as Chief Financial Officer. Drummond brings more than 15 years of accounting and finance experience to his new role. He joins Fogelman’s executive team and will be responsible for the company’s corporate finances, investment and property accounting and corporate planning. Prior to joining Fogelman, Drummond was the Chief Financial Officer at Envolve Communities, LLC, where he also served as Chief Accounting Officer and Vice President of Financial Reporting and Investor Relations. Prior to Envolve Communities, Drummond was a Senior Manager at Ernst & Young. He also was a Financial Reporting Analyst for Education
Realty Trust, Inc.

Peter Larson   •   Senior VP of Residential Property Management   •   Bernstein Management Corporation   •   Washington, D.C.

Bernstein Management Corporation welcomed Peter Larson as Senior Vice President of Residential Property Management. Larson will direct the operational strategy for BMC’s portfolio of over 5,000 multifamily units throughout the Washington, D.C., metro. Prior to joining Bernstein, Larson was with Horning Brothers, most recently serving as Vice President of Property Management, following 10 years working as a Regional Property Manager for firms including Greystar, Waterton Residential and Kettler.

 

Christopher Reed   •   President   •   Beacon Residential Management   •   Boston

Beacon Communities has hired Christopher Reed as President of Beacon Residential Management, Beacon’s property management company. Reed will be responsible for the overall strategic direction, operation and profitability of Beacon’s property management company and real estate portfolio. As part of this work, he will be focused on the enhancement of resident satisfaction, resident services and employee engagement consistent with the mission of the company.  Reed most recently served as Executive Vice President, Property Management at Mercy Housing Management Group. Reed previously held leadership roles at Equity Residential Trust, Lexford Residential Trust and Lexford Properties, Inc. He holds several industry certifications, including the accreditations of CPM, NAHP-e, CPO and SHCM.
